식물 표현형은 식물의 물리적 및 생화학적 특성을 측정하고 분석하여 환경 조건, 유전학 및 관리 관행에 대한 반응을 이해하는 과정을 말합니다. 여기에는 다양한 기술과 도구를 사용하여 형태학, 생리학, 성장, 발달 및 대사와 같은 식물 특성에 대한 연구가 포함됩니다. 식물 표현형에서 얻은 데이터는 육종 프로그램, 작물 개량 및 식물과 환경 간의 상호 작용을 이해하는 데 도움이 될 수 있습니다.
식물 표현형은 온도, 습도, 영양소 가용성과 같은 다양한 환경 조건에서 작물의 성능에 대한 귀중한 통찰력을 제공할 수 있습니다. 농부와 연구자는 심기 밀도, 비료, 관개와 같은 작물 관리 관행을 최적화하고 해충 및 질병에 대한 저항성이나 환경 스트레스에 대한 내성과 같은 바람직한 특성을 가진 새로운 작물 품종을 개발하는 데 도움이 될 수 있습니다. 바이오매스 축적, 잎 면적, 광합성 효율, 뿌리 구조와 같은 광범위한 식물 특성에 대한 데이터를 수집함으로써 연구자와 농부는 다양한 환경 조건에서 작물의 성능에 대한 귀중한 통찰력을 얻을 수 있습니다.

The plant phenotyping market is categorized into different product segments, including equipment, software, and sensors. Equipment is further divided into several sub-segments, such as site, platform/carrier, level of automation, analysis system, and application. Software is also segmented into various categories, such as data acquisition, image analysis, system control, data management, schedule assistant, experiment design, and database configuration. Additionally, sensors are divided into image sensors, normalized difference vegetation index (NDVI) sensors, temperature sensors, humidity sensors, and ultrasonic distance sensors. On the basis of service, the plant phenotyping market is segmented into Data Acquisition, Analysis, and others. Data Acquisition services typically involve the collection of data on plant growth and development using various sensors and imaging technologies. This data is then processed and analyzed to extract relevant information about plant traits and characteristics. Analysis services, on the other hand, involve the interpretation and analysis of plant phenotyping data to extract meaningful insights and draw conclusions. This can involve the use of advanced software tools and algorithms to identify patterns and relationships within the data. Other service category, involves consulting and training services, custom software development, and technical support services. These services can help to support the development, deployment, and use of plant phenotyping technologies in a wide range of applications, such as crop breeding, plant research, and product development.

Trait identification involves the use of plant phenotyping technology to identify specific traits, such as root length, leaf area, and biomass, that are important for crop performance. Photosynthetic performance is another important application of plant phenotyping, as it provides information on the efficiency of photosynthesis in plants, which is crucial for plant growth and development. Morphology is another important application of plant phenotyping that involves the measurement and analysis of plant structure, such as stem diameter, leaf angle, and plant height.

Greenhouse phenotyping involves conducting experiments in a controlled environment that mimics natural conditions. This provides researchers with precise control over environmental factors such as temperature, humidity, light intensity, and CO2 concentration. Laboratories are another important end-user segment of the plant phenotyping market. Laboratory-based plant phenotyping involves the use of controlled environments and advanced imaging and analytical tools to study plant growth and development. This can be particularly useful for studying plant responses to specific environmental stimuli, such as temperature, light, and nutrient availability. Field-based plant phenotyping is another important end-user segment of the market, as it involves the study of plant growth and development in natural environments, such as farms and fields. This can provide valuable insights into the performance of crops under different environmental conditions and can help farmers to optimize their crop management practices.
